Corteva Stock Institutional Investors

Have you ever been surprised when a price of an equity instrument such as Corteva is soaring high without any particular reason? This is usually happening because many institutional investors are aggressively trading Corteva backward and forwards among themselves. Corteva's institutional investor refers to the entity that pools money to purchase Corteva's securities or originates loans. Institutional investors include commercial and private banks, credit unions, insurance companies, pension funds, hedge funds, endowments, and mutual funds. Operating companies that invest excess capital in these types of assets may also be included in the term and may influence corporate governance by exercising voting rights in their investments.

Corteva Greeks

Most traded equities are subject to two types of risk - systematic (i.e., market) and unsystematic (i.e., nonmarket or company-specific) risk. Unsystematic risk is the risk that events specific to Corteva or Chemicals sector will adversely affect the stock's price. This type of risk can be diversified away by owning several different stocks in different industries whose stock prices have shown a small correlation to each other. On the other hand, systematic risk is the risk that Corteva's price will be affected by overall stock market movements and cannot be diversified away. So, no matter how many positions you have, you cannot eliminate market risk. However, you can measure a Corteva stock's historical response to market movements and buy it if you are comfortable with its volatility direction. Beta and standard deviation are two commonly used measures to help you make the right decision.

The market value of Corteva is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Corteva that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Corteva's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Corteva's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Corteva's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Corteva's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Corteva's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Corteva is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Corteva's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
